tt_default_ptype_set(library call) tt_default_ptype_set(library call)NAMEtt_default_ptype_set -- set the default ptypeSYNOPSIS#include <Tt/tt_c.h> Tt_status tt_default_ptype_set( const char *ptid);DESCRIPTIONThe tt_default_ptype_set function sets the default ptype. The ptid argument must be the character string that uniquely identifies the process that is to be the default process.RETURN VALUEUpon successful completion, the tt_default_ptype_set function returns the status of the operation as one of the following Tt_status values: TT_OK The operation completed successfully. TT_ERR_NOMP The ttsession(1) process is not running and the ToolTalk service cannot restart it. TT_ERR_PROCID The current default process identifier is out of date or invalid.SEE ALSOTt/tt_c.h - Tttt_c(5). tt_default_ptype_set(library call)
